(D)Fraction is a dynamic math-learning app designed to transform fraction mastery into an engaging adventure. Combining vibrant visuals with bite-sized lessons, it helps students aged 8–14 conquer fractions through puzzles, mini-games, and real-world scenarios. The app’s adaptive algorithm tailors challenges to individual skill levels, making it ideal for both beginners and advanced learners. With instant feedback and progress tracking, (D)Fraction turns intimidating math concepts into a rewarding journey.
Features of (D)Fraction:
1. Interactive Tutorials: Step-by-step guides simplify complex fraction operations like addition, multiplication, and simplification.
2. Gamified Learning: Earn rewards by solving puzzles, unlocking new levels, and collecting virtual trophies.
3. Progress Dashboard: Track improvement with detailed analytics, including accuracy rates and time spent per topic.
4. Offline Mode: Access core lessons without internet, perfect for classrooms or travel.
5. Parent/Teacher Portal: Monitor student progress and customize learning paths via a separate dashboard.
Advantages of (D)Fraction:
1. Zero Ads: Distraction-free environment enhances focus.
2. Kid-Friendly Design: Colorful animations and relatable characters keep younger users motivated.
3. Adaptive Difficulty: Automatically adjusts problem complexity based on performance.
4. Cross-Platform Sync: Seamlessly switch between tablets, phones, and desktops.
Disadvantages of (D)Fraction:
1. Limited Advanced Content: Focuses primarily on foundational skills; lacks higher-grade topics like algebraic fractions.
2. Subscription Model: Full access requires a monthly fee after the free trial.
3. Minimal Social Features: No multiplayer options or peer competition tools.

Competitive Products:
- Fraction Blaster: Offers faster-paced gameplay but lacks detailed progress reports.
- MathMasters: Includes broader math topics but has intrusive ads.
- Slice Fractions: Renowned for storytelling but limited to basic concepts.
(D)Fraction stands out with its adaptive tech and offline capability, though rivals may better cater to niche needs.
